New Release: Minor Key (Wynter Wild Book 8)

The eighth book in the Wynter Wild saga, Minor Key, is out now in all ebook formats!

The title for Minor Key was inspired by two events in the story, the first being Xay and Wynter’s long-awaited reunion after 3 years. Things don’t go exactly as either of them planned, and neither knows quite what to do about it.

The second is the tragedy alluded to in the blurb (below).

In addition, Jesse is dealing with a mental health issue that takes him by surprise.

But there are happy times, too.

Rule212 goes on tour! It’s an opportunity for quality bonding time as well as giving Wynter the chance to be in charge. Caleb meets someone who could become very special to him if he can figure out the logistics (and he’s a logistics man). And Indio’s still working to figure out where he fits into this family.

Three years ago, Xay Morant left Wynter to face the nightmare alone. She’s been searching for him ever since–and now he’s found her first.

But it’s not easy to pick up the pieces of a past you’re trying to forget. As Wynter and her brothers prepare to head off on tour with their band, Xay needs to figure out where he fits in.

When tragedy strikes this already wounded family, where will they find healing?

CONTENT WARNINGS: The series as a whole (meaning not all warnings apply to all books, in order to avoid spoilers) includes or refers to: child abuse, premature death, drug use and abuse, animal cruelty, not-very-graphic sex and violence, mental health issues, and adult relationships. Wynter does not have sexual abuse/assault in her past or her future.
